= Transporting Museum Labels =

The printed labels for the new Fennick Wing gallery come back from the binder's shop this week. They're fragile — mounted on foamboard, so no stacking and keep them flat. The office manager signs the delivery slip personally. For the courier hand-over, apply the following instruction.

drop instructions, kawip-yajep: the julix fenwyn courier leaves the quenmir druius silath pelys pelys norwyn rusox quenius ledger at gate 3778 under passcode 988264

## Per-tenant rate quotas

Quotas in Brindlewick are enforced at the gateway, per tenant, with a token bucket refilled every tick. We deliberately kept the knobs few — past attempts at per-endpoint quotas turned into config sprawl nobody could reason about. If you're tuning these, change one at a time and watch the shed rate. The current defaults are below.

tuning table, kajog-kawef:
PRIORITIES = {
    "kelox": 870,
    "kasix": 89,
    "eliax": 988,
}

Ticket #4471 — Vault locked after replica-lag alarm

The Ombrel read-replica lag alarm fired at 03:12 and the failover script triggered an automatic seal on the Corvette credentials vault, as designed. Replica lag has since recovered to under two seconds, but the vault remains locked and downstream dashboards can't fetch tokens. Support should unseal using the standard recovery flow on the Ketter console. The passphrase required by the unseal prompt is provided directly below.

vault phrase of tajeg-tageg = pelix-druix-holius-briael-zorwyn-frawyn-fraox-norok-drueth-aldiel